Could some one tell me the best order to sew together the 3 pieces in the corner blocks? I understand I need to stop 1/4 inch from the end but do I add both sides to the small square and then join the corners? Everyway I have tried feels so difficult. Thnaks in advance!

JeanieG 07-18-2011 02:53 PM


Originally Posted by marymc
Could some one tell me the best order to sew together the 3 pieces in the corner blocks? I understand I need to stop 1/4 inch from the end but do I add both sides to the small square and then join the corners? Everyway I have tried feels so difficult. Thnaks in advance!

I sewed the square on last after the other pieces were put together. Seemed to work out OK for me. Hope that helps.
